The Waves

The Waves

by Virginia Woolf

1950

Six childhood friends, bound by the ebb and flow of life, narrate their individual journeys from youth to old age. Woolf masterfully captures their shared experiences and solitary reflections through a unique, lyrical exploration of consciousness.
